Tethys Robotics develops autonomous underwater robots that enable precise, reliable inspections in turbid and high-current environments where conventional ROVs or divers fail. Our hybrid ROV/AUV system “Tethys ONE” combines advanced sensor-fusion navigation with modular payloads for visual, sonar, and ultrasonic inspection. By automating underwater data collection and reporting, we help operators in offshore wind, hydropower, and utilities reduce costs, minimize vessel time, and improve safety. The global subsea inspection market exceeds €5 billion annually, driven by the growing need for sustainable asset monitoring in renewable and critical infrastructure.

Venture Kick supports potential entrepreneurs with start capital up to CHF 150'000 as well as hands-on execution support and access to a nationwide network of investors and experts in the startup field. Multiple times per year, 8 selected projects get the opportunity to present their business ideas in front of a panel. The 5 most promising projects enter the support process. After 9 months at the latest, the startups incorporate and enter the market. Since 2007, Venture Kick has invested over CHF 58 million in over 1111 projects.
